The state of Maine became the first to use a ranked choice ballot to select members of the U.S. Senate and House of Representatives during the 2018 midterms. Jonathan Fishman, selectman for the town of Lincolnville, Maine and drummer for Katy's favorite band, Phish, explains the benefits of a ranked choice system.Nov. 28, 2018
